Здравствуйте, Аноним, Вы писали:
А>а подскажи как их блокировать, надо и себе их залочить. А>Там надо что то в .htaccess подшаманить? Файл .htaccess надо в каждую папку кинуть?
Не, все сложнее.
Надо взять базу ip-диапазонов, конвертнуть ее в access/mssql/mysql/нужноеподчеркнуть (они текстовые изначально).
Потом определить IP-шник поль-ля, пересчитать его в 4-байтовый int, в базе найти диапазон, которыму он принадлежит и определить код страны. Далее
Можно по другому — на лету спрашивать какойнть whois, но через whois половина стран не определяется. Там бывает ответ типа "Country: EU (country is really worldwide)" — и ничего не определишь.
Re[3]: кого блокировать
От:
Аноним
Дата:
18.08.05 11:48
Оценка:
Здравствуйте, jit, Вы писали:
jit>Здравствуйте, Аноним, Вы писали:
А>>а подскажи как их блокировать, надо и себе их залочить. А>>Там надо что то в .htaccess подшаманить? Файл .htaccess надо в каждую папку кинуть?
jit>Не, все сложнее.
jit>Надо взять базу ip-диапазонов, конвертнуть ее в access/mssql/mysql/нужноеподчеркнуть (они текстовые изначально).
Здравствуйте, Аноним, Вы писали:
jit>>Надо взять базу ip-диапазонов, конвертнуть ее в access/mssql/mysql/нужноеподчеркнуть (они текстовые изначально). А>А где бы её взять?
Купить. Стоит от 15 баксов. Погугли "ip2location" "ip2country". А еще есть ТОННЫ шароварных компонентов для сайта на php, asp, perl, которые написаны уже за вас.
Есть и фриварные базы, но они в большинстве out-of-date года на 3-4 отстают (появляются новые провайдеры, им выделяются адреса...) Вот у моего хостера стоит такая база и у меня 35% запросов к сайту Unknown
wrote in message news:1334546@news.rsdn.ru... > Может тогда проще по языку или по рефереру (я подозреваю, что это уже можно через .htaccess)? Чтобы не ошибиться и не откидывать нормальные IP.
Тогда ты ошибишся и откинешь пользователей, у которых по каким-то причинам неправильный язык, и наоборот (у меня например стоит только en-us, хотя я в России).
Posted via RSDN NNTP Server 1.9
Re[5]: кого блокировать
От:
Аноним
Дата:
18.08.05 14:08
Оценка:
Здравствуйте, wellwell, Вы писали:
w>Тогда ты ошибишся и откинешь пользователей, у которых по каким-то причинам неправильный язык,
это как можно китайский случайно поставить
w>и наоборот (у меня например стоит только en-us, хотя я в России).
Я не говорил, что 100%-ый метод, но все же лучше чем залочить по ошибке нормальную страну.
Кстати IP тоже не 100%-ый, т.к. можно через прокси зайти, ты же не бужеш все прокси блокировать.
Здравствуйте, wellwell, Вы писали: W>Тогда ты ошибишся и откинешь пользователей, у которых по каким-то причинам неправильный язык, и наоборот (у меня например стоит только en-us, хотя я в России).
Я думаю эту фичу мало кто меняет. А еще могут несколько языков добавить.
А вот есть системный язык, он у китайца должен быть китайским, а у wellwell точно не китайский.(99% русский)
посылаем серверу navigator.systemLanguage и анализируем
"devic" <37574@users.rsdn.ru> wrote in message news:1334661@news.rsdn.ru... > Я думаю эту фичу мало кто меняет. А еще могут несколько языков добавить. > А вот есть системный язык, он у китайца должен быть китайским, а у wellwell точно не китайский.(99% русский) > посылаем серверу navigator.systemLanguage и анализируем
У меня все английское (включая винды и ИЕ), вплоть до default locale
Здравствуйте, Аноним, Вы писали:
А>Здравствуйте, jit, Вы писали: А>Может тогда проще по языку или по рефереру (я подозреваю, что это уже можно через .htaccess)? Чтобы не ошибиться и не откидывать нормальные IP.
ИМХО, реферер — самый разумный способ. У меня как-то выложили кейген на одном сайте, так оттуда хлынул поток халявщиков. Блокировка всего одного этого сайта практически нормализовала трафик.
Здравствуйте, retalik, Вы писали:
R>ИМХО, реферер — самый разумный способ. У меня как-то выложили кейген на одном сайте, так оттуда хлынул поток халявщиков. Блокировка всего одного этого сайта практически нормализовала трафик.
Не исключено, что пришедший с варезника человек может и купить программу, а на варезник он попал через Гугль, как раз ища вашу программу.
К тому же кардеры идут не только с варезных сайтов, как раз наоборот. В swrus недавно обсуждали — процент чарджбека в китае чуть ли не 80%. Нафик-нафик. У меня за каждый чарджбек штраф в 20 баксов.
Здравствуйте, jit, Вы писали:
jit>Здравствуйте, retalik, Вы писали:
R>>ИМХО, реферер — самый разумный способ. У меня как-то выложили кейген на одном сайте, так оттуда хлынул поток халявщиков. Блокировка всего одного этого сайта практически нормализовала трафик.
jit>Не исключено, что пришедший с варезника человек может и купить программу, а на варезник он попал через Гугль, как раз ища вашу программу.
Это есть истина. Я даю скидку если человек пришел с "крякнутой" версии. Удивительно, но покупают